This release includes a chat-style help panel in Designer which uses AI to answer your questions regarding how to use FastClose to achieve the reporting needs of your business.
Retrieval of Planning & Budgeting data to desktop clients is now handled by a secure Planning API. This makes it possible to do planning (both submissions and reporting) over wide area networks where clients don't have direct access to the planning database (FC-2043)
The ERP type no longer needs to be specified when creating a planning data source, eliminating the possibility of setting the wrong type and encountering confusing errors later on. (FC-2082)
After saving a connection that includes planning, feedback is provided to the user while waiting for the initialization of the database to complete in the Admin web app. (FC-2025)
If a new version of the desktop app is available but not mandatory, the login dialog now includes a direct link to the installer, and announces this in a less intrusive manner. (FC-181)
A user interface improvement designed to help users pick the correct option (unlink or update) when editing a library object. (FC-2083)
When selecting a range of non-numeric cells in the results grid, the 'Count' statistic in the status bar now shows the number of cells selected (FC-2068)
Show a warning if importing templates or solutions results in zero objects being imported. (FC-2039)
Friendlier feedback is given to the user if Nextworld reports a 'Not authorized to read' error. (FC-1687)
The 'Share Schema' option in the ERP Connections page in Admin web app only appears when there are qualifying data sources and is less prominently presented to avoid inappropriate selection. (FC-2034)
Version 3.1.3 contains all the fixes released for 3.0.x up to 3.0.9, plus those below.
Submission could fail with an error if there was no ERP scenario in the report. (FC-2093)
Submitting against SAP B1 using FastClose Server schema caching fails with 'Could not find a unique key for table' error. (FC-2058)
Refreshing planning master data fails with SAP B1 due to lack of table unique key information. (FC-2060)
Refreshing planning master data should not proceed unless there is a valid planning licence. (FC-2084)
Copying and pasting in the Captions Override dialog could result in an error. (FC-2069)
The Date Selection dialog would become excessively wide when populated with a complex, custom date filter. (FC-2072)
The correct feedback was not shown when logging in with username & password when the desktop client is less than the minimum client version. (FC-2089)
When Windows Authentication is used, the client and server version compatibility wasn't being checked. (FC-2100)
Login didn't work when running FastClose Server under IIS using Windows Authentication. (FC-2040)
An upcoming licence expiry warning should not be logged as an error. (FC-2015)
Refreshing the FastClose Server schema cache fails for tables whose schema name is non-default, which can be the case with SAP B1 on HANA. (FC-2061)
Some third-party libraries used by FastClose applications have been updated to eliminate or mitigate disclosed security vulnerabilities. (FC-2057)
